
I haven't had a computer since 2001 but after struggling to easily buy a new graphics card (which keeps selling out) I decided to give this computer a shot because it came with a Geforce RTX 3070. I was immediately impressed with just the *case* because it was easy to open and set up so installing my extra hard drives was a breeze. Then I booted it up and it's probably the quietest computer I've ever had. I'm so used to the last computer I built sounding like a jet engine with all its fans. This PC has one case fan, one CPU fan and two GPU fans and is QUIET. As a test, I installed Cyberpunk 2077 and set *all* graphics settings to maximum, and the game looks and runs great. This machine is quick and easy to set up. I couldn't be happier. I may never build my own computer again.
